Church hosts dinner for unemployed workers, families

People out of jobs because they've been laid off or downsized have something to look forward to.

St. Luke's Episcopal Church, at 119 N. 33rd St. in Billings, is hosting a free dinner on Tuesday at 6 p.m. for unemployed people and their families. The church would like people to RSVP by Friday, at 252-7186, so there will be enough food to go around.

Guest speaker for the dinner will be Dr. Ann Rathe, a Billings psychiatrist, who will speak on "Keeping Your Sanity in a Bad Economy."

Often, people who lose their jobs grapple with a lot of negative feelings, said the Rev. Gary Waddingham, rector of the downtown church.
